I just did the refurbishment some weeks ago (ok... a company did it for me).
So I just had to remove the headlight and take out the reflectors. It was pretty straight forward. You just have to take out the headlight assemblies, and then taking out the reflectors. You just have to be careful not to brake any plastic clips. There is a clip in one of the corners, visible from the front, a rubber tube at the middle and an another clip at the middle which you can reach from the back side. Everything had to be removed from the reflector (bulb, bulb holder wire spring, etc) and a local company removed the original "silver" layer, vaporized a new one and put a protective varnish on top. The 2 reflectors cost me ca. 50usd.
The result is amazing. Really like a brand new. Obviously I do not know how long it will last, the company states they are using the same technology as the headlight manufacturers. It is done in a vacuum chamber, but based on the price it does not look like something which is done only by one company in the world.
(It was funny, that the guy just looked on the reflectors in wrapped bubble foil and asked right away whether it is a Volvo... looks like this was not first Volvo reflector they did
)

Target price per headlight reflector should be of order $10 per, probably reachable in a 10 piece bulk order. $50 isn’t competitive with TYC when you realize you get two bulbs , too

Thanks for finding and sharing info about vacuum metalization. That seems like the procedure we need to properly coat our reflectors. I think it's a good idea to preserve original Volvo parts instead of buying aftermarket, so I'm interested in this project. Restoration may cost more than buying a new aftermarket set, but it may be worth it to keep the original beam patterns and build quality of the Volvo parts.
